About Lawyer / Attorney
A Lawyer / Attorney (commonly called an Advocate in India) advises clients on legal rights and obligations, drafts and reviews documents, negotiates on your behalf, and represents you in courts, tribunals, and other forums (subject to the Advocate’s enrollment and practice permissions).
You may need a Lawyer / Attorney in Mumbai when you’re signing or disputing a contract, buying/selling property, facing a police complaint or criminal allegation, planning a business restructuring, dealing with workplace issues, resolving family disputes, or responding to notices from regulators and government bodies.
Average cost in Mumbai: fees vary widely based on the lawyer’s seniority, matter complexity, urgency, and forum. In practice, Mumbai pricing can range from a few thousand rupees for a basic consultation to significant professional fees for high-stakes litigation or corporate transactions. If you want a predictable budget, ask for a written fee estimate, billing model (hourly/appearance/fixed), and likely additional expenses.
Licensing/certifications: In India, legal practice is regulated by the Bar Council of India and the relevant State Bar Council. In Maharashtra, advocates are typically enrolled with the Bar Council of Maharashtra & Goa (enrollment details vary by lawyer). Court appearances generally require a valid enrollment and compliance with applicable court rules.

Cost of Hiring a Lawyer / Attorney in Mumbai
Mumbai legal fees are highly variable because the market includes solo practitioners, boutique litigation chambers, and large full-service firms. For individuals, common starting points are paid consultations and fixed-fee drafting for standard documents; for businesses, billing is often retainer-based or hourly, with team-based staffing.
Average price range (general market guidance):
- Basic consultation: often ₹1,000–₹5,000+ (varies / depends)
- Drafting/review of a straightforward agreement or notice: often ₹5,000–₹50,000+
- Court appearances: often ₹5,000–₹50,000+ per appearance depending on court, seniority, and urgency
- Complex litigation/arbitration and corporate transactions: varies widely and can be significantly higher
Emergency pricing: urgent filings, late-night drafting, same-day appearances, or injunction matters may be billed at a higher rate due to compressed timelines and increased risk.
What affects cost
- Matter type (civil/criminal/family/corporate/regulatory) and forum (court/tribunal/arbitration)
- Seniority of the Lawyer / Attorney and team composition (partner vs associate support)
- Urgency and turnaround time (same-day drafting, emergency hearings)
- Documentation volume (contracts, annexures, evidence, translations, stamping)
- Complexity and risk (injunctions, custody, white-collar allegations, high-value disputes)
- Out-of-pocket expenses (court fees, notarization, couriering, travel, photocopying)
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
How much does a Lawyer / Attorney cost in Mumbai?
It varies / depends on the matter, urgency, and lawyer’s seniority. Many lawyers charge a paid consultation, then bill via fixed fees, per-appearance fees, or hourly/retainer models.
How to choose the best Lawyer / Attorney in Mumbai?
Start with specialization and forum experience (family court, high court, arbitration, etc.). Ask for a written scope of work, fee structure, timeline expectations, and who will handle day-to-day work.
Are licenses required in Mumbai?
Yes. To practice as an advocate in India, the professional must be enrolled under the relevant State Bar Council and governed by Bar Council rules. If you need court representation, confirm active enrollment details.
Who offers 24/7 service in Mumbai?
24/7 availability varies / depends and is not publicly stated for many practices. For urgent matters, ask directly about after-hours support, emergency filings, and response times before you engage.
What documents should I bring to a first legal consultation?
Carry a brief written timeline and all key papers: IDs, contracts, notices, emails/WhatsApp exports if relevant, property papers, FIR/complaint details (if any), and any court filings already made.
How long does a legal case take in Mumbai?
Timelines vary widely by forum, complexity, and interim applications. Some matters resolve in weeks via negotiation; contested litigation can take much longer.
Can a Lawyer / Attorney in Mumbai handle both drafting and court work?
Some do, especially in smaller practices. Larger firms may split work across teams. Ask who will draft, who will argue, and whether a specialist counsel is needed for hearings.
What’s the difference between an Advocate and a Lawyer / Attorney in Mumbai?
In everyday usage, people say “lawyer/attorney,” but “advocate” is the common Indian term for someone entitled to practice law and appear in courts (subject to rules). The practical difference depends on enrollment and role.
Should I choose a local Mumbai lawyer or someone from another city?
For Mumbai-based disputes, local familiarity with courts, procedures, and logistics can help. For specialized work (e.g., niche regulatory issues), the best fit may be a specialist regardless of city—coordination still matters.
How do I avoid unexpected legal bills?
Ask for a written engagement letter, billing intervals, who will work on the matter, and what is excluded. Clarify whether court fees, stamping, travel, and filing expenses are billed separately.
